hdml是什么(什么是 HDML?)
随着移动互联网的快速发展,智能手机已经成为人们生活中不可或缺的一部分。为了满足用户对移动应用的需求,各种编程语言和技术应运而生。其中,HDML(Handheld Device Markup Language)是一种专门用于描述移动设备上显示内容的标记语言。我们将深入探讨 HDML 的相关内容,包括它的定义、特点、应用场景以及未来的发展趋势。通过,读者将对 HDML 有一个全面而深入的了解。
HDML 是什么
HDML 是一种用于创建移动设备上显示内容的标记语言。它最初是由诺基亚公司开发的,旨在为其移动设备提供一种简单、轻量级的标记语言,以便在移动设备上显示各种类型的内容,如文本、图像、链接等。HDML 基于 XML(eXtensible Markup Language,可扩展标记语言),并在其基础上进行了扩展和定制。

HDML 的特点
1. 简洁性:HDML 是一种简洁的标记语言,它只包含了一些必要的标记和属性,以便在移动设备上显示内容。这使得 HDML 非常适合用于创建简单的移动应用程序。
2. 可扩展性:HDML 基于 XML,因此具有很好的可扩展性。开发人员可以根据自己的需求自定义标记和属性,以满足特定的应用需求。
3. 跨平台性:HDML 可以在多种移动设备上运行,包括诺基亚的塞班系统、黑莓等。这使得开发人员可以使用一种标记语言为多种移动设备创建应用程序,提高了开发效率。
4. 低资源消耗:HDML 是一种轻量级的标记语言,它对移动设备的资源消耗非常低。这使得 HDML 非常适合用于资源有限的移动设备,如低端手机。
HDML 的应用场景
1. 移动应用程序开发:HDML 最初是为移动应用程序开发而设计的。开发人员可以使用 HDML 创建简单的移动应用程序,如新闻阅读器、天气预报应用程序等。
2. 移动网站开发:HDML 也可以用于创建移动网站。开发人员可以使用 HDML 创建一个简单的移动网站,以便在移动设备上浏览。
3. 企业应用程序:HDML 可以用于创建企业应用程序,如移动 CRM、移动 ERP 等。这些应用程序可以帮助企业员工在移动设备上访问企业数据和应用程序,提高工作效率。
HDML 的未来发展趋势
1. HTML5 的兴起:随着 HTML5 的兴起,HDML 的市场份额逐渐被 HTML5 所蚕食。HTML5 是一种更加先进的标记语言,它支持更加丰富的多媒体内容和交互性。未来 HDML 的发展可能会受到一定的影响。
2. 移动设备的发展:随着移动设备的不断发展,用户对移动应用程序的需求也在不断变化。未来,HDML 可能需要不断地更新和改进,以满足用户的需求。
3. 跨平台开发的需求:随着跨平台开发技术的不断发展,HDML 可能会逐渐被其他跨平台开发技术所取代。例如,React Native、Flutter 等跨平台开发技术可以使用一种代码在多种移动设备上运行,这可能会对 HDML 的市场份额产生一定的影响。
HDML 是一种专门用于描述移动设备上显示内容的标记语言。它具有简洁性、可扩展性、跨平台性和低资源消耗等特点,因此被广泛应用于移动应用程序开发、移动网站开发和企业应用程序等领域。随着 HTML5 的兴起和移动设备的不断发展,HDML 的市场份额可能会逐渐被 HTML5 所蚕食。未来 HDML 的发展需要不断地更新和改进,以满足用户的需求。